Abstract
The article discusses two theatrical concepts introduced at different periods of the 20th century: Theater of Cruelty of Antonin Artaud and Theater as Benevolent Anarchy of Tennessee Williams. The comparative analysis of the two systems makes it possible to discover certain common features and purposes and reveals the typological similarity between them.
